Seniors in an independent living community would appreciate Washington, Missouri for its vibrant atmosphere and accessibility to essential services and recreational activities. The city boasts the scenic Washington Riverfront Park, perfect for leisurely strolls or picnics, enhancing social interaction among residents. Additionally, the local Senior Center offers various programs tailored to seniors, including fitness classes and arts and crafts workshops that foster creativity and connection. Proximity to medical facilities like Mercy Hospital ensures residents have easy access to healthcare when needed, making Washington a welcoming place for seniors seeking an active lifestyle.

Considerations for seniors living in Washington, MO
Access to Healthcare: Washington has several healthcare facilities, including Mercy Hospital and Washington Care Center, which can provide seniors with access to medical care.
Outdoor Activities: Seniors in Washington can enjoy spending time outdoors at the riverfront park, Katy Trail State Park or city parks like Memorial Park.
Cultural Enrichment: The community boasts of cultural institutions like Washington Historical Society and Museum and the Midwest Bluegrass and Gospel Music Association.
Affordable Cost of Living: The cost of living in Washington is lower than the national average, making it easier for seniors to afford housing, transportation, groceries, and other necessities.
Transportation Services: The city provides public transportation services through its OATS Transit system offering easy movement within the town as well as intercity travels
Community Involvement: The area has an active senior center that offers social activities for seniors such as bingo nights, card games, and group outings.
